Output 9c677ac3842815a4628d9126576d3e38c4ef50f2aa5331fc8219724f5c03f0de:0

value
17448344
script pubkey
OP_HASH160 OP_PUSHBYTES_20 646befd7c646bfe2505c98f321857e0e8c125dd6 OP_EQUAL
address
3AqzoK7cK4EkAo2atyJi2NVeFdetXG1fCk
transaction
9c677ac3842815a4628d9126576d3e38c4ef50f2aa5331fc8219724f5c03f0de
confirmations
277817
spent
true